Afghan journalist stabbed to death

Well-known Afghan journalist Sayed Hamid Noori died on Sunday after being found with stab wounds outside his Kabul home.

President Hamid Karzai issued a statement ordering authorities to spare no effort in bringing the killers to justice.

Noori, a former state television presenter and newspaper editor, was vice president of Afghanistan's Association of Independent Journalists (AIJ) and a teacher of young journalists.

AIJ president Abdul Hameed Mubarez said Noori had left home after receiving a series of phone calls, suggesting that he either knew his assailants or had been set up.
